Abstract

This chapter presents a significant emergence from an ongoing spiritual and health and spiritual health promotion research dialogue between Holt and Greenford involving mutually beneficial academic peer support and supervision. Our informal ongoing dialogue currently extends back over more than seven years. Together we introduce you to our emerging approach to inquiring about the phenomena of spirituality and health, and spiritual health promotion. Our evolving approach is Complex Reflective Technê (CRT).
